To participate in a 1031 exchange, you must first sell your existing property, which is known as the “relinquished property.” All deadlines for the exchange process are based on the closing date of the relinquished property, not the contract date.
Once you’ve sold your relinquished property, the next step in a 1031 exchange is to identify potential replacement properties to buy. This is a crucial step in the exchange process, and it must be completed within 45 days of the sale of the relinquished property.
The final step is to purchase the replacement property within 180 days of selling the relinquished property. This six-month window allows you to find and close on a suitable replacement that meets your investment goals and the exchange requirements.

It began as a rural crossroads and was named after William Waldorf Astor in the early 20th century. Today, although not officially an incorporated city, Waldorf has a vibrant community feel and offers a great quality of life for its residents.
With a population of approximately 76,000, Waldorf has grown significantly in recent years and is one of the fastest-growing areas in Maryland. The diverse population includes families, young professionals, and retirees, contributing to a dynamic and inclusive community. With its proximity to Washington, D.C., Waldorf offers a blend of suburban living with easy access to urban amenities.
In terms of real estate, Waldorf has a competitive market with a variety of housing options. The median home value in Waldorf is around $300,000, making it an affordable choice for many homebuyers. The real estate market is active, with a range of single-family homes, townhouses, and apartments available.
